In this episode of China Q&A, Huang Yiping, Dean of the National School of Development at Peking University, discusses why China is placing greater emphasis on "investment in people."
He points to the role of human capital, strengthened through education, innovation, and social welfare, as a key driver of an innovation-led economy. This strategy can help raise consumer confidence while supporting the broader goal of improving living standards. Included in China's 15th Five-Year Plan, the approach signals a shift from the traditional focus on infrastructure toward people-centered development.
